For years, Santiego Rivers believed that fear, failure, anxiety, depression, childhood trauma, and painful mistakes would define the rest of his life. Like so many others, he spent years surviving instead of truly living, carrying burdens he was never meant to carry and believing the lies that told him he wasn't enough.
Then everything changed.
In A Work in Progress, Rivers invites readers on a deep personal journey of faith, healing, and transformation. With honesty, vulnerability, and biblical wisdom, he shares how God helped him confront his past, reclaim his identity, protect his peace, and discover that healing isn't about becoming perfect. It's about becoming willing.
This is more than a book about healing.
It's a reminder that your mistakes don't define you, your scars don't disqualify you, and your story isn't over.
You are not broken. You are being built.
Because being a work in progress isn't a sign that God has given up on you. It's proof that He is still working.
